The animation you see at the top of the page is from a CKK Twister. Here's a real pic though:
It was a lot like a M-Tech Twist, but without the Twist's problems. Good connector hardware and more metal. Blade was .02" thicker and the whole thing just felt more substantial than a Twist. It was a pretty fantastic deal for $55.
It went away when the Twist showed up. It was only available for a few months in the Fall-Winter of '08, I think.
